If you are trying to go back to 2.2 you have to flash the stock sbf zip that brings you back to 2.2, re-root ,re- install dx bootstrap ,( wipe)flash back up of liberty. You may have to re activate phone,and I hear when you flash back and might even boot loop.

If you used the Gingerbread file from early this am it has a broken stock recovery. P3 put out a patch for that. If you got it later in the day it should be ok. If you see the choices but can't select try using the power button to select instead of the camera button which won't work. Go to New and the info should be in the root Gingerbread thread.
